When you have thick oil in your engine and it is cold outside, the various metal components of the engine might cling against each other when you first go to start it up. This will cause ticking noises to come from the engine. The noises should gradually stop after a couple of minutes. Read also:

Thick over thin When painting with heavy colour, it is best to apply thick layers over thin layers. This is because the thin layers dry more quickly. Web10 Mar 2024 · Dip your brush into the solvent. If you want to thin your paint only slightly, then dip just the tip of your brush into the solvent. If you want to thin your paint to a more soupy consistency, dip most of your brush into the solvent. Bring your brush over to your paint and mix it together on your palette.
